> 唯美句子 > 单片机中~符号是什么意思

单片机中~符号是什么意思

简单程序如下:

sbit d0 = P1^1;

int main(void)

{

while(1)

{

d0 = ~ d0; //把单片机P1.1端口数据取反, 1变成0或者0变成1

}

}

单片机中符号是什么意思比如说,d0=d0

具体是什么符号?这么说没有用。比如说一个还是错误的,没有这么写的,估计是你看错了,这么写没有一点意义的。

单片机 点操作符 是什么意思?例如PSW.5或0D0H.5是什么意思?

PSW.5是PSW的D5位,即F0标志位 ,PSW的地址是D0H,所以D0H.5就是PSW.5

单片机接口是数据线D0~D7是什么作用

主要是传输数据的,一般的八位单片机能够同时处理八位数据D0-D7组成数据总线,一次可传输8位数据。

#C51单片机# 程序中0DFFFH是什么意思?

访问外部数据存储器时,P2口是高8位地址线

选第一片时高8位地址线 必须P2.5=0, P2.4=1,其余地址线任意

选第二片时高8位地址线 必须P2.5=1, P2.4=0 其余地址线任意

51单片机中,i = d & 0x01;是什么意思?d也是16进制数字

51单片机中,i = d & 0x01;意思是将变量d的高7位清0,保留最低位,结果赋值给变量i

单片机原理中TCON^7指的是D7 还是D0? P^7指的是D7(最高位) 还是D0(最低位)

TCON^7指的是TCON这个可位寻址的字节的D7,D0是TCON^0;P^7指的是P这个可位寻址的字节的D7。不可位寻址字节这样写编译会出错。

单片机中定义sbit d0=P0^7后,程序还能出现P0^7吗?例如以下

程序中的^号会认为是异或操作,不能这么写.

另外你要保证a是位变量.

单片机中dgnz是什么指令?

你好!

这是汇编指令, DJNZ是用来控制循环次数的,比如:DJNZ 10H,del

意思就是执行这一句,后面的那个十六进制数10H自动减一,看是不是0,不是0就跳到del的标识符语句后,是0就顺序执行。 希望我的回答对你有帮助!

pic单片机 movlw d'100'是什么意思

Pic单片机里的指令movlw d'100"有以下说明:

意思是把100(D代表十进制),存入寄存器W(相当于51单片机里的累加器),

D代表十进制

B代表二进制,例如B‘111111111’

H代表16进制,10H或0X10表示

单片机中~符号是什么意思:等您坐沙发呢!

发表评论

您必须 [ 登录 ] 才能发表留言!